TVS Motor Company Ltd has witnessed a notable 13.6% increase in open interest in its derivatives segment, signalling heightened market activity and evolving investor positioning. Despite a slight decline in the stock price, the surge in open interest alongside rising volumes suggests a complex interplay of bullish and bearish bets among traders.
TVS Motor Company Sees Significant Open Interest Surge Amid Mixed Market Signals

Open Interest and Volume Dynamics

On 24 Jul 2026, TVS Motor Company Ltd’s open interest (OI) in futures and options contracts rose sharply to 1,29,084 contracts from the previous 1,13,609, marking an increase of 15,475 contracts or 13.62%. This surge in OI was accompanied by a futures volume of 85,282 contracts, reflecting robust trading activity. The combined futures and options value stood at approximately ₹23,53,478 lakhs, underscoring the significant capital flow in the derivatives market for this large-cap automobile stock.

The underlying stock price closed at ₹3,875, just 2.77% shy of its 52-week high of ₹3,974.7, indicating that the stock remains near its peak levels. However, the day’s trading saw a reversal after three consecutive days of gains, with the stock touching an intraday low of ₹3,823.3, down 2.46% from the previous close. This price action, combined with the open interest spike, points to a nuanced market sentiment.

Market Positioning and Investor Sentiment

The increase in open interest alongside a slight price decline often suggests that new positions are being built, possibly reflecting a mix of directional bets. Traders may be hedging existing long stock positions or initiating fresh short positions anticipating a near-term correction. Conversely, some investors might be positioning for a breakout, given the stock’s proximity to its 52-week high and its trading above all key moving averages – 5-day, 20-day, 50-day, 100-day, and 200-day.

Investor participation has also risen notably, with delivery volumes on 23 Jul reaching 10.39 lakh shares, a 46.52% increase over the five-day average. This heightened participation suggests that institutional and retail investors alike are actively engaging with the stock, possibly in response to recent earnings, sectoral trends, or broader market cues.

Technical and Fundamental Context

TVS Motor’s current trading levels above all major moving averages indicate a sustained uptrend over multiple time horizons. This technical strength is supported by the company’s large-cap status with a market capitalisation of ₹1,83,877.72 crores, placing it among the prominent players in the automobile sector. The sector itself has been under pressure, with a 1-day return of -1.40%, slightly worse than TVS Motor’s own decline of -1.26%, but better than the Sensex’s -0.45% fall on the same day.

The company’s Mojo Score stands at 55.0, reflecting a Hold rating, upgraded from a Sell on 22 Jun 2026. This upgrade signals improving fundamentals or market positioning, though the score suggests cautious optimism rather than a strong buy recommendation. Investors should weigh this alongside the recent open interest surge, which may indicate increased speculative activity or hedging rather than a clear directional conviction.

Implications for Traders and Investors

The spike in open interest combined with rising volumes and delivery participation suggests that market participants are actively repositioning ahead of potential catalysts. These could include upcoming quarterly results, sectoral policy announcements, or macroeconomic developments impacting the automobile industry. The mixed signals from price action and derivatives data imply that traders should monitor key support levels near ₹3,820 and resistance around the 52-week high of ₹3,975 closely.

Given the stock’s liquidity, with an average traded value supporting trade sizes up to ₹14.16 crores, institutional investors can manoeuvre sizeable positions without significant market impact. This liquidity, coupled with the derivatives market activity, makes TVS Motor a focal point for both hedging strategies and directional bets in the near term.
